The retention factor is calculated by multiplying the distribution frequent by the volume of stationary section in the column and dividing by the volume of cell phase inside the column.

When the circulation price is simply too minimal, the longitudinal diffusion variable ((dfrac B v )) will boost appreciably, that can boost plate top. At small move prices, the analyte spends far more time at rest while in the column and so longitudinal diffusion in a far more considerable trouble. In the event the flow rate is too higher, the mass transfer term ((Cv)) will increase and lower column effectiveness. get more info At large circulation costs the adsorption from the analyte into the stationary period results in many of the sample lagging behind, which also brings about band broadening.

This chromatographic system relies on the aptitude in the bonded Lively substances to form steady, specific, and reversible complexes as a result of their biological recognition of specified specific sample elements. The development of such complexes requires the participation of common molecular forces such as the Van der Waals interaction, electrostatic interaction, dipole-dipole conversation, hydrophobic conversation, and the hydrogen bond.
